1953 Triumph Mayflower

I took these photographs at a classic car show in Hyde, Cheshire, in October 2022.
It’s a 1953 Triumph Mayflower which was built by the Standard Motor Company and was in production from 1949 to 1953.
Nicknamed the 'Razor Edge' like its big brother the Triumph Renown, it had a 4-cylinder inline side-valve 1,247cc engine.
 It was built in Coventry and  was also assembled in Port Melbourne, Australia and Nyköping, Sweden.

1983 Austin Ambassador

I took these photographs at a classic car show in Hyde, Cheshire in October 2025.
It's a 1983 Auston Ambassador and has a 4-cylinder inline 1,994cc engine.
The note in the windscreen of the car reads as follows:

Austin Ambassador
 
The Ambassador is what ADO71,
the Austin Princess became in its final form.
The conversion to Ambassador was codenamed LM19 and cost just £19M.
Ambassador was a stop-gap model before LC10,
the Montego and Maestro were launched.
 
This was a mainstream model but only 44,000 examples were made,
between 1982 and 1984 and now to many peoples’ surprise, only 74 survive including
only 13 in Vanden Plas trim and only 17 in total are known to be on the road!
 
The advanced features of Harris Mann’s design include:-
crumple zones with a rigid passenger cell,
fold-away steering wheel to protect ribs in an accident,
front wheel drive for accuracy in all road conditions,
Hydragas suspension, linked front to rear giving legendary comfort,
a huge boot, masses of legroom, especially in the back, and wedge styling.
Over the Princess, the ambassador has bigger, improved Hydragas suspension units,
wider wheels, the dashboard is all new, there is an air dam at the front
to further reduce drag and it is a hatchback.
 
The decision not to build the Princess in the first place as a hatchback was because
BL wanted a saloon car, so as not to compete with its own Rover SD1.
 
Despite being ‘badged’ an Austin, Ambassadors were at Cowley, Oxford,
the former Morris factory where BMW Minis are built today.
 
Here is a very rare British car to be proud of.

2002 Bentley Arnage

This is one of the vehicles that took part in a classic car show on the market square in Hyde in September 2021.
It’s a 2002 Bentley Arnage.
It has a 6,750cc twin-turbo V8 engine.
883 of these cars were produced in 2002, and a total of 7397 between 1998 and 2009.

1934 Triumph Gloria

 This is one of the cars that took part in a car show on the market square in Hyde in October 2025.
It's a 1934 Triumph Gloria, a car that the Triumph company produced from 1932 to 1938.
It has a 4-cylinder inline 1,087cc Coventry Climax engine that was modified and built under licence by Triumph.

2001 Rover 75

This is one of the vehicles that took part in a classic car show on the market square in Hyde in September 2021.
It’s a Rover 75, a model which was produced from 1998 to 2005 with various engine sizes ranging from a 4-cylinder inline 1.8 litre to a 4.6 litre V8.
According to the DVLA record  this one is a 2001 model with a 1,997cc V8 engine and currently has a SORN, the last MoT certificate having expired in September 2023.

1997 BMW Z3

This was one of the cars taking part in the Hyde Classic Car Show on the Market Square in September 2021.
It's a 1997 BMW Z3 with a 1,895cc 4-cylinder inline engine.
The car was introduced in 1995 and production ended in 2002.
The quarters of the inner circle on the BMW badge display the state colours of BMW's home state of Bavaria – white and blue.

1996 Jaguar XJ Sport

This is one of the cars on display at the Hyde Classic Car Show in September 2021.
It's a 1996 Jaguar XJ Sport

The car has a 6-cylinder inline 3,980cc Jaguar AJ6 engine

Over 90,000 of these cars were produced between 1994 and 1997
